With a mantra of Empowering Human Potential, Hanger, Inc. is the world's premier provider of orthotic and prosthetic (O&P) services and products, offering the most advanced O&P solutions, clinically differentiated programs and unsurpassed customer service. Hanger's Patient Care segment is the largest owner and operator of O&P patient care clinics nationwide. Through its Products & Services segment, Hanger distributes branded and private label O&P devices, products and components, and provides rehabilitative solutions to the broader market. With 160 years of clinical excellence and innovation, Hanger's vision is to lead the orthotic and prosthetic markets by providing superior patient care, outcomes, services and value. Collectively, Hanger employees touch thousands of lives each day, helping people achieve new levels of mobility and freedom.


In this role, you will have the opportunity to provide administrative support to patients, fellow employees and referral sources through the coordination and administration of the front office activities. The ideal candidate will have a background in an administrative role with strong computer proficiency, and customer service. Typical responsibilities include scheduling appointments, validating insurance and payment authorization, inputting claims, processing payments, performing account collections, conducting billing research and responding to telephone inquiries.


  • Obtaining insurance authorization
  • Daily document research on an electronic health/medical record system
  • Providing financial counseling for patients and posting over the counter (OTC) payments
  • Creation of new patient charts and maintenance of patient records
  • Scanning and filing patient documents and ensuring complete and accurate information
  • Managing incoming phone calls
  • Responsible for patient appointment scheduling
